No Callouts
Double check the installation folder for the callouts. They should be here: Grand Theft Auto V\plugins\LSPDFR If you do not have the LSPDFR folder inside of plugins, then create it.

SuperCallouts
Rewrite is basically done now. I'm just making sure everything is running great. There are issues with the version uploaded here right now so I will release the beta version of SuperCallouts soon to fix those issues. Sorry for taking so long, I really got burnt out with the rewrite. Adding new callouts is fun, but re-writing what I have already made was very difficult to keep motivated. For Beta 2.0 What going on right now: Just finishing up adding UI to the last few callouts. Fixing old swat callouts to run. Currently all the suspects just run away and the callout ends. What's done: Everything is rewritten from the core up. This will make the plugin much more stable. Even if I make a mistake somewhere it will no longer crash LSPDFR, instead it will just cancel the current callout. I've added new classes that allow me to do things very quickly that normally would take a long time. Added full RageNativeUI support (UI Elements) Integration with StopThePed. (Searching vehicles, Searching Peds, drunk / high testing) Integration with Ultimate Backup. (Backup will automatically be dispatched or controlled by callouts.) Added interaction menu. (Default key is Y, every callout has a menu.) Added ability to speak with suspects / victims from most callouts (This is an unfinished feature. Currently only 1 story for each of them. The future will have multiple outcomes with different stories.) What will not be included yet: Updated swat callouts. Some callouts will not be included with the beta. Future Plans: 15+ new callouts. Add more outcomes to current callouts so no two calls will be the same. Totally new swat callouts that will be much more detailed. Investigation callouts. (Talk to people, search for evidence, eventually find suspect. Chance to fail these callouts.) On the grind callouts. (These will be more like real work, meaning no crazy dead people or shootouts. Just strait simple pullovers / fake calls.) Integration with SuperEvents. Meaning some events could result in a special callout related to it. (This is just an idea, i'm not sure what i'll do so no promises.)

SuperCallouts
Next update is almost ready, currently it adds a UI and interactions to all callouts. Complete rewrite of the code to fix issues that could pop up while the callouts are running. That should solve issues people are having. Best I could do without logs but this will prevent the callouts from crashing LSPDFR. Nothing new added yet, just minor changes to existing callouts. Swat callouts have not been changed at all yet, but I plan to completely rewrite and add a lot more interaction to those as soon as I finish this first half of the update. Currently all that's left for me to rewrite is: Manhunt Open Carry Robbery After that i'll release it, then start work on remaking all the swat callouts and add a couple new things. Also will add new content to super events. Sorry for slow progress, I was a little burnt out and wanted to do other stuff for a bit. New update will have similar requirements to the events. For a good experience you will need to have Ultimate Backup and Stop The Ped installed. Searched items will only work with STP searches, and the way the callouts will call for backup automatically is with Ultimate Backup. Callouts will work without them, but it's not recommended.
